Butch,

My system is profiled as well. When I print to my Epson 3800, and when I send my work out to labs for larger prints, the prints match the screen exactly.

With the canvas, the colors didn't shift, but they are muted (lack of contrast basically). Based on reports here, some prints are coming out great. I have seen some of the pictures and they indeed have good contrast.

After seeing my results, I think I could have made the required adjustments if a proofing profile was available. If anyone has other suggestions as to the varied results, please chime in.

I am glad yours came out as you wanted it. The comapny seems to be doing many things right.

I did an online chat with the company and explained how my image came back with a lack of contrast. They made it clear that they "aren't a color matching lab", quoting them directly.

They said others have brought this issue up before and they are considering providing profiles, but obviously, they haven't yet.

This was a good experiment for me. I do like the canvas concept, and can see where my image would look very nice with some adjustments for the canvas output.

I will probably pursue this with a company that provides profiles though so the guess work is reduced/eliminated.

Well, one more experience.
Quick turn around, no shipping problem. Printed a 20x30 canvas from an 8MP image. Slight soft at the edges in the original. The canvas was as sharp as my original print (at 11x17), slight less saturated (but the original image had extremely intense blues in the Bermuda water). Original was also on semigloss Ilford paper. Museum wrap style worked well. Came with "beehive" mounting pieces, instructions.
Overall, very pleased.

Hi all,

I suspect the mentioned prints are not treated with a coating or varnish. This can be a problem with dark colours and blacks. Can anyone confirm this?


Hi Duncan,

I try to print some serious quality on my IPF8000 but I'm still searching for a trick to fold the canvas without cracking.

To prevent cracking I apply varnish first and frame the next day.
I would like to offer the customer a choice, no varnish (lower price/lower contrast/easier damaged/lower glare etc) or varnish. But with the cracking issues I don't feel satisfied.

I tried several canvases (stretching and non stretching).

Gert - first, don't varnish first, it will always crack that way. Second, getting the good/proper media is what eliminates cracking. Which media are you using?
